can i swap a can electrolitic cap for a ceramic ?
im converting a preamp for a guitar to smt to reduce size. its a "Tillman preamp"
it has two caps one is 10uf the other is 4.7 uf, they are there for dc blocking and pass an ac signal could i use a ceramic smt in its place with same value
 
I cannot see any reason why not having looked at the cct diagram.

**broken link removed**

Electrolytics used to be far cheaper, but that not an issue unless you plan on mass production. Still 18pence per cap isn't too bad.
 
Just make sure that the cap voltage rating is adequate.
